Facility moves into Spar store
The new post office in Ramsey opens its doors for the first time this morning (Mon 20th)
The facility is housed within the Spar store on Parliament Street and will feature six counter positions and a foreign exchange service.
It will continue to be run by Mannin Retail, with dedicated post office staff currently based in the courthouse building relocating to the new office.
